About Maryam Eidi
Maryam Eidi is a scholar working on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, Pharmacology, Nutrition and Dietetics, Plant Science and Molecular Biology, having authored 47 papers that have together received 1.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Natural Antidiabetic Agents Studies (18 papers), Diet, Metabolism, and Disease (6 papers), Phytochemicals and Antioxidant Activities (5 papers), Essential Oils and Antimicrobial Activity (5 papers),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(4 papers), Pharmacological Effects of Natural Compounds (4 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(3 papers) and Mast cells and histamine (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biochemistry (225 citations),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(504 citations), Complementary and alternative medicine (249 citations), Pharmacology (217 citations) and Plant Science (496 citations). Maryam Eidi has collaborated with scholars based in Iran, Austria and Bangladesh. Frequent co-authors include Akram Eidi, Elham Davtalab Esmaeili, Hamid Reza Zamanizadeh, Mohammad-Reza Zarrindast, Shahrbanoo Oryan, Alireza Sadeghipour, Ali Saeidi, Kazem Parivar, Ali Haeri Rohani and Nasser Ghaemi. Their work appears in journals such as Iranian journal of pharmaceutical research, European Journal of Pharmacology, Urolithiasis, Phytotherapy Research and Renal Failure.
